MBM Resources records RM63.5mil net profit


PETALING JAYA: MBM Resources Bhd recorded a net profit of RM63.53mil for the first quarter ended Mar 31, 2026 (1Q26), down from RM71.39mil from the same quarter a year ago.

The group reported a quarterly revenue of RM543.72mil, representing a 5.3% decline from the RM574.32mil in 1Q25.

MBM Resources said the lower profits involved declines across its subsidiaries, joint venture and associates, in line with overall market weakness.

The share of results from its joint venture saw a 21.7% decline in profit to RM3.3mil, mainly due to lower production demand from carmakers, the group said.

On a quarterly basis, revenue fell by RM193.1 million or 26.2%, primarily due to the scheduled plant shutdowns by several carmakers in both Feb and Mar 2026.

This, it said, resulted in fewer working days in 1Q26 and moderation in demand.
